The UK recorded its lowest temperature in more than two decades as the mercury plunged to minus 23C overnight following an “extreme freeze”.
Braemar, Aberdeenshire, saw temperatures hit a bone-chilling minus 23.0C (minus 9.4F), the coldest temperature recorded in the UK since 1995, the Met Office said.
